<div dir="ltr"><div dir="ltr"><div class="gmail_default" style="font-size:large">Here's how I like to do it these days:</div><div class="gmail_default" style="font-size:large"><br></div><div class="gmail_default" style="font-size:large">[phasor~]</div><div class="gmail_default" style="font-size:large"> |</div><div class="gmail_default" style="font-size:large">[expr~ $v1 < 0.5]</div><div class="gmail_default" style="font-size:large"> |</div><div class="gmail_default" style="font-size:large">[snapshot~] (with [bang~]</div><div class="gmail_default" style="font-size:large"> |</div><div class="gmail_default" style="font-size:large">[change]</div><div class="gmail_default" style="font-size:large"> |</div><div class="gmail_default" style="font-size:large">[sel 1]</div><div class="gmail_default" style="font-size:large"> |</div><div class="gmail_default" style="font-size:large">BANG!</div><div class="gmail_default" style="font-size:large"><br></div><div class="gmail_default" style="font-size:large">If you need it to be sample accurate, you can set [block~ 1].</div><div class="gmail_default" style="font-size:large"><br></div><div class="gmail_default" style="font-size:large">Even better if you can keep it all in the signal domain and skip the [snapshot~], but it depends on your purpose.</div><div class="gmail_default" style="font-size:large"><br></div><div class="gmail_default" style="font-size:large">Sam</div><div class="gmail_default" style="font-size:large"><br></div><div class="gmail_default" style="font-size:large"><br></div></div><div class="gmail_quote"><blockquote class="gmail_quote" style="margin:0px 0px 0px 0.8ex;border-left:1px solid rgb(204,204,204);padding-left:1ex"><br>
Content-Type: text/plain; charset="iso-8859-1"<br>
<br>
Hi there,<br>
I assume this has been discussed many times before but...what could be simplest and most concise way to detect a phase reset of a phasor~ with only plain vanilla objects?<br>
I only need one bang when it goes back to 0.<br>
It seems I should need snapshot~ and fexpr~ which is not that elegant...<br>
-------------- next part --------------<br>
An HTML attachment was scrubbed...<br>
URL: <<a href="http://lists.puredata.info/pipermail/pd-list/attachments/20220316/37d4b25a/attachment-0001.htm" rel="noreferrer" target="_blank">http://lists.puredata.info/pipermail/pd-list/attachments/20220316/37d4b25a/attachment-0001.htm</a>><br><br>
</blockquote></div></div>